Aerin
83 Main Street, Southampton
7 Newtown Lane, East Hampton
There are a handful of Aerin stores across the US, but only in high-end shopping destinations, like near the Hamptons homes for sale or Miami. Aerin has perfected the Hamptons design aesthetic, and it’s a great place to shop if you’re looking to outfit a new room or redesign what you currently have, you can find what you’re looking for here. Both stores in the Hamptons are great, but the East Hampton shop is a particular favorite due to the location, just off Main Street.
Clic General Store
60 Newton Lane, East Hampton
Clic started its journey as a bookstore in East Hampton, a small, independently owned shop. It was a great place to stop after looking at Hamptons houses for sale and before you hit the beach. Clic still sells books, but they also sell art, home decor items, and a small selection of Hamptons staple fashion items. Everything in the space is carefully curated, and it’s hard to leave with nothing.
Kirna Zabete
66 Newton Lane, East Hampton

Kirna Zabete Boutique sells designers that can be hard to find near most Hamptons houses for sale, or really outside the city at all. Saint Laurent, Marc Jacobs, Valentino and more are all featured here. The staff work hard to produce the best pieces from each designer, but there is also an exclusive Kirna Zabete collection as well available here. It’s all very Hamptons-chic.
Blue & Cream
60 The Cir, East Hampton
Just down the street from the East Hampton location of Aerin is Blue & Cream, a boutique shop that is a little off-brand for Hamptons. This boutique stocks A.P.C., Phillip Lim, and other edge-y designers that you can’t always find near Hamptons houses for sale. There is also an in-house collection that has great wardrobe staples and beach favorites.
Joey Wolffer
11 Madison Street, Sag Harbor
Step outside of East Hampton and into Sag Harbor shopping. Joey Wolffer is a designer specializing in a free-spirited, bohemian style. She doesn’t just sell her own unique designs, though; she also has a curated selection of vintage and designer clothes and accessories. That means that there are things you simply can’t find anywhere else because they don’t exist. The Hamptons homes for sale have great access to this unique shop year-round.
Brunello Cucinelli
39 Newton Lane, East Hampton

If you’ve never heard of Brunello Cucinelli, he is a legendary luxury fashion designer from Italy that has designed some incredible pieces over the years. He’s best known for his cashmere, but his store in East Hampton has a great selection of home goods, luxurious clothing choices, and hard-to-find pieces from recent collections.
Intermix
87 Main Street, East Hampton
Intermix doesn’t sound like the name of a fashionable boutique with a huge variety of designers, but it actually is. This curated shop has designers like Jimmy Choo, Alexander Wang, and Valentino, and it is near some of the best East Hamptons houses for sale. There’s always something new, so if you don’t find what you’re looking for at first, just keep checking back.
Katherine Tess Boutique
69 Main Street, Southampton
This boutique located in Southampton is named for designer and owner Katherine Tess, and the store features her own designs, along with a handful of other select designers that fit the aesthetic. The store has a colorful, bright vibe and feels positive when you walk in. It’s a great place to pick up something new, and there is even a small selection of household items. If you’re looking at The Hamptons homes for sale, you can get unique or interesting designer pieces for your home without going into the city.
London Jewelers
2 Main Street, East Hampton

London Jewelers have been located near Hamptons houses for sale since 1920, and have continually sold some of the best high-end jewelry outside of the city. They sell the brands and designers you expect as well as custom pieces from their in-house team, and can handle repairs, cleaning, and more. This is a one-stop jewelry shop for everything you need to feel and look your best.
